Spurs vs. Warriors Betting Trends
- The Spurs have compiled a 3-4-3 record against the spread this season.
- The Warriors are 5-6-1 against the spread this season.
- This season, six of the Spurs' games have gone over the point total out of 12 chances.
- Warriors games this year have gone over the total in seven of 12 opportunities (58.3%).
- In home games, San Antonio owns a better record against the spread (2-1-2) compared to its ATS record in road games (1-3-1).
- The Spurs have gone over the over/under less consistently when playing at home, hitting the over in two of five home matchups (40%). In away games, they have hit the over in four of five games (80%).
- This season, Golden State is 4-0-1 at home against the spread (.800 winning percentage). Away, it is 1-6-0 ATS (.143).
- In 2025-26 a lower percentage of the Warriors' games have finished above the over/under at home (40%, two of five) compared to on the road (71.4%, five of seven).
Spurs Leaders
- Victor Wembanyama is averaging 25.7 points, 3.4 assists and 12.8 rebounds.
- Stephon Castle's numbers on the season are 18.5 points, 5.7 rebounds and 7.7 assists per game, shooting 48.8% from the field and 25.0% from downtown, with an average of 1.1 made treys.
- Devin Vassell averages 13.8 points, 3.8 rebounds and 2.1 assists.
- Keldon Johnson is averaging 12.0 points, 1.7 assists and 5.4 boards.
- Julian Champagnie's numbers on the season are 9.5 points, 5.3 boards and 1.5 assists per contest, shooting 39.7% from the field and 34.0% from beyond the arc, with an average of 1.8 made 3-pointers.
Warriors Leaders
- Jimmy Butler III averages 18.3 points for the Warriors, plus 5.3 rebounds and 4.4 assists.
- The Warriors get 25.0 points per game from Stephen Curry, plus 3.3 rebounds and 3.8 assists.
- The Warriors are receiving 14.9 points, 6.8 rebounds and 3.1 assists per game from Jonathan Kuminga.
- Brandin Podziemski's numbers on the season are 12.0 points, 4.7 rebounds and 3.1 assists per contest. He is sinking 45.2% of his shots from the field and 36.4% from beyond the arc, with an average of 1.7 treys.
- Draymond Green's numbers on the season are 7.9 points, 5.3 boards and 5.6 assists per contest. He is sinking 46.3% of his shots from the floor and 44.2% from 3-point range, with an average of 1.7 treys.
